10 Questions You Should Know About Automotive Sheet Metal Stamping Services

  1. What is sheet metal stamping?
    Sheet metal stamping is a manufacturing process that involves shaping metal sheets into specific forms using dies and presses. This technique is commonly used to create parts for vehicles, such as body panels and brackets.
  2. What materials are typically used in sheet metal stamping?
    Common materials used for automotive sheet metal stamping include steel, aluminum, and sometimes copper. These materials are chosen for their strength, weight, and cost-effectiveness.
  3. How is the stamping process carried out?
    The stamping process generally involves the following steps: 1. Design and create a die based on the part specifications. 2. Feed sheet metal into the stamping machine. 3. Apply pressure to the die to form the metal into the desired shape. 4. Remove the finished part and trim any excess material.
  4. What are the benefits of sheet metal stamping in automotive manufacturing?
    The benefits include high precision, cost-effectiveness, and the ability to produce complex shapes quickly. Additionally, it allows for mass production, which can reduce costs while maintaining quality.
  5. Can sheet metal stamping be used for custom parts?
    Yes, sheet metal stamping can be tailored for custom parts. However, the setup costs for dies can be high, making it more economical for larger production runs. Prototype parts can also be produced using different techniques if necessary.
  6. What is the role of dies in sheet metal stamping?
    Dies are essential tools in the stamping process. They determine the shape of the final product and are crucial for achieving accurate dimensions. Proper die maintenance is vital for efficient production.
  7. How do manufacturers ensure quality in stamped parts?
    Manufacturers use various quality control measures such as dimensional checks, material inspections, and stress tests. They might also employ automated systems for real-time monitoring of the stamping process.
  8. What are common defects in stamped parts?
    Common defects include warping, cracking, and surface imperfections. These issues can arise from improper die alignment, incorrect material thickness, or inadequate press settings.
  9. How is sustainability addressed in sheet metal stamping?
    Many manufacturers are adopting sustainable practices such as recycling scrap metal and using energy-efficient machines. These efforts help reduce waste and lower the overall environmental impact of the stamping process.
  10. What trends are shaping the future of sheet metal stamping in the automotive industry?
    Trends include the increased use of lightweight materials for better fuel efficiency, automation in production processes, and advancements in technology such as 3D printing for prototyping and die creation.
